Summary:
Reporting to the Manager of Public Safety & Security, the Special Police Officer, licensed with the Security Officer Management Branch, provides a safe and pleasant environment for all visitors, guests, and employees to the property. The Special Police Officer performs protective and enforcement functions when coping with undesired behavior, disturbances, crime, and threats to life and property. In all situations, the Officers perform their duties in a courteous, professional, and restrained manner, through legal methods approved and in compliance with provisions of the District of Columbia Code, Sections 4-114 and 4-115 and company policies.
This is a part-time, year-round position scheduled to work up to 34 hours per week and is designated as an “essential employee.” As such, the Special Police Officer may be required to stay beyond regular work hours and/or report in from off-duty to assist with minimum staffing coverage.
